The disgraced war criminal has been welcomed to Government House in Perth to receive the honour bestowed by King Charles III.

Disgraced former special forces soldier Ben Roberts-Smith has been welcomed into Western Australia’s Government House to receive a special honour from King Charles III, a year after a federal court judge concluded the ex-corporal had executed and brutalised Afghan prisoners and disgraced the nation’s military.

Governor Chris Dawson refused to comment or answer repeated questions about the event at government house. It is not clear whether he was personally involved in Thursday’s event at Government House. During the trial, Roberts-Smith’s lawyers accused multiple SAS soldiers who implicated him in war crimes ofover Roberts-Smith’s Victoria Cross. This was wholly rejected in Justice Besanko’s judgment.

The Office of the Special Investigator, an elite policing agency probing war crimes, has a dedicated taskforce gathering evidence about Roberts-Smith’s involvement in summary executions in Afghanistan between 2006 and 2012.
